更多“若二维数组a有m列,则计算任一元素a[i][j]在数组中位置的公式为()(假设a[0][0]位于数组的第一个位置上)”相关的问题
第1题
将M行N列的二维数组按列为主序存放,首个元素a00存于地址B(占d个字节),则元素aij的地址是
A.B+(i*M+j)*d
B.B+(i*N+j)*d
C.B+(j*M+i)*d
D.B+(j*N+i)*d
点击查看答案
第2题
将M行N列的二维数组按行为主序存放,首个元素a00存于地址B(占d个字节),则元素aij的地址是
A.B+(i*M+j)*d
B.B+(i*N+j)*d
C.B+(j*M+i)*d
D.B+(j*N+i)*d
点击查看答案
第3题
将M行N列的二维数组按行为主序存放,首个元素a00存于地址B(占d个字节),则元素aij的地址是
A.B+(i*M+j)*d
B.B+(i*N+j)*d
C.B+(j*M+i)*d
D.B+(j*N+i)*d
点击查看答案
第4题
若二维数组a有m列,则在a[i][j]前的元素个数为:
A.i*m+j
B.j*m+i
C.i*m+j-1
D.i*m+j+1
点击查看答案
第5题
二维数组A[0..5][0..6]按列为主序存储在起始地址为1000的内存单元中,每个元素占5个字节,则元素A[5][5]的地址是
点击查看答案
第6题
定义了二维数组 int a[3][3]={{1,2},{3,4},{5,6,7}};则数组元素a[2][2]的值是:
点击查看答案
第7题
将三对角矩阵A[1..100][1..100]按行为主序存入一维数组B[1..298]中,则元素A[66][65]在B中的位置为
点击查看答案
第8题
定义一个二维数组:int arr[][] = {{0}, {1,2},{ 3, 4,5}};,数组元素a[1][1]的值是
点击查看答案
第9题
将三对角矩阵A[1..100][1..100]按行为主序存入一维数组B[1..298]中,则元素A[66][65]在B中的位置为
点击查看答案
第10题
对m行n列的未经压缩(即以二维数组表示)的稀疏矩阵进行转置,时间复杂度是
A.O(m)
B.O(n)
C.O(m*n)
D.O(max(m, n))
点击查看答案